Ingredients
1 lb chicken breast, cut into bite-size pieces
2 tbsp Cajun seasoning
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p black pepper
2 tbsp olive oil
3 tbsp unsalted butter
4 cloves garlic, minced
8 oz elbow macaroni or cavatappi
1 1/2 cups heavy cream
4 oz cream cheese, softened
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
1/3 cup grated parmesan cheese
1 tsp garlic powder
1 tsp onion powder
1/2 tsp paprika
1 cup crispy fried onions
1 tbsp chopped fresh parsley (optional)
Instructions
1. Cut chicken breast into small, even pieces and season with Cajun seasoning, salt, and pepper.
2. Heat olive oil and 1 tablespoon of butter in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add garlic and cook for 30 seconds.
3. Add chicken and sear until golden and cooked through, about 8–10 minutes. Remove from skillet and set aside.
4. Bring salted water to a boil in a large pot and cook pasta until al dente. Drain and set aside.
5. In a saucepan, melt remaining butter. Add heavy cream and whisk in cream cheese until smooth.
6. Stir in gar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, and remaining Cajun seasoning. Add cheddar and parmesan; stir until melted.
7. Toss cooked pasta into the sauce, stirring to coat thoroughly. Let it simmer for 1–2 minutes to thicken slightly.
8. Plate the creamy pasta and top with garlic butter chicken bites.
9. Finish with crispy fried onions and chopped parsley, then serve hot.
Notes
Let the cream cheese soften at room temp to help it melt quickly and smoothly into the sauce.
Don’t overcrowd the skillet when searing chicken—cook in batches if needed for best texture.
For extra spice, stir in a pinch of cayenne or serve with hot sauce on the side.
